PER CURIAM.
Upon a plea of guilty, Ronald J. Evans was convicted of robbery. He received an indeterminate sentence of fifteen years plus a consecutive, five-year term for the use of a firearm while committing the crime. The judgment of conviction recited that the consecutive term was imposed "as [a] mandatory sentence according to Idaho Code 1925-20A" (apparently referring to I.C. § 19-2520A). For reasons explained below we modify the sentence.
